Job Summary

***This position is hybrid and requires travel to the administrative building in Warsaw IN. Must be able to travel to office when necessary.***

Duties/Responsibilities:

Below are the primary duties and essential functions of an employee in this position. While not all tasks may be performed by every employee in this role all employees are expected to perform related tasks as needed. These essential functions must be performed with or without reasonable accommodation.

  • Administer and maintain Oracle environments including databases applications and integrations.
  • Monitor system performance conduct routine maintenance and monitor patch application/ testing. Maintain test scripts as needed.
  • Ensure high availability data integrity and security of Oracle systems.
  • Act as the primary point of contact for national contracted Oracle support services.
  • Provide technical support coordinate escalations track issue resolution and ensure service level agreements are met.
  • Develop and maintain internal processes for vendor interaction including documentation of support workflows and escalation paths.
  • Create and maintain comprehensive documentation for Oracle system configurations workflows and support procedures.
  • Troubleshoot and resolve issues related to financial workflows reporting and data accuracy working closely with the Accounting department.
  • Identify and document tasks and responsibilities that are not covered by external Oracle support.
  • Ensure documentation is regularly updated and accessible to relevant stakeholders.
  • Other duties as assigned.

Required Qualifications:

  • Bachelors degree in computer science Information Systems or related field; or equivalent experience.
  • 4 years of experience in Oracle system administration or enterprise application support.
  • Experience supporting Oracle Financials or similar ERP modules.
  • Strong understanding of Oracle architecture database management and system integration.
  • Excellent communication and documentation skills.
  • Valid drivers license and active liability insurance.
  • Satisfactory results from criminal background check.
